RE: Getting some sort of glitching / Interference.
Well that SUCKS, Kenny! I'd thought for sure that the ferrite ring would cure your servo-woes / interference issues.[:'(] I wonder if it could be the BL motor, have you tried removing the motor from the ESC (pull 2 of the BL wires off, motor won't run on 1 phase). Does it still twitch? If you change throttle position does that change anything?
Shadow